What are the function of an enzymes of the animals body​

Biology
1 answer:
Mekhanik [1.2K]3 years ago
7 0
In animals, an important function of enzymes is to help digest food. Digestive enzymes speed up reactions that break down large molecules of carbohydrates, proteins, and fats into smaller molecules the body can use... hope this helps

The statement force equals mass times acceleration is Newton second law of motion.why is this law rather than a theory
ololo11 [35]

Answer:

The statement “force equals mass times acceleration” is Newton's second law of motion. It is a law rather than a theory because it states, rather than explains, the relationship between the variables.
